christep 18th May 2007 12:33

I have to say from the SLF perspective I would love to use their Clark flights, but the cancellation and short-notice retiming makes this completely infeasible. They don't seem to realise that there is a very good market for HK-Clark based round the number of people in HK who either are Pampangans or are married to one. But they aren't cheap package tourists - they need reliable, well-timed regular service, for which they will pay something approaching the cost of a CX ticket to NAIA plus the taxi fare up to Angeles. Unfortunately, at the moment HK Airlines just doesn't seem to get it.

HK Harbour Rat 1st Jun 2007 03:28

Bazbogan,

as a new joining SFO you will make roughly 51,000 HKD

School fees will likely run a minimum of 5K per kid a month (for a average school) up to where for a really good school.

Rent is at the very least 10-12K + power (1.5K) water, cable ect... (2K)

So at a minimum over 1/2 your salary is out the door and you haven't cracked a VB yet..

Tax will eat about 10% in that bracket aswell.
